How to Measure
-
1
Chest
Button or zip up your jacket and lay it flat on a hard surface. Measure across the chest area of the jacket about an inch down from the underarm seam, and double that for the full chest measurement.
-
2
Shoulder
Measure straight across the back of the jacket, from one shoulder seam to the other.
-
3
Sleeve Length
Measure from the top of the shoulder seam to the end of the cuff. Next, measure from the center back of the neck seam to the shoulder seam. Add these two values to get your sleeve measurements.
-
4
Length
Measure straight down the back of the jacket, from the center of the neck seam to the bottom of the hem.

Description
This is a cropped winter Bomber cut from a hearty 24 oz felted British wool. The same wool that the Royal Air Force used for multiple centuries. The Monterey has a clean finished hem with a brass D-ring cinch to keep the wind at bay. Where traditional bombers ride up in the cuffs because of a lack of articulation in the shoulders, the Monterey is outfitted with a bi-swing back shoulder for total range of motion. This jacket is a celebration of spectacular wool, applied to a really ingenious Bomber pattern, that lends polish to a timeless, cold-weather staple.
